I think it would be neat if they offered in addition to the "standard colors" that every car comes in, a "continuously evolving color."

I.E. You would have 1 color that they would only do in 3-6 month runs, then replace it with another color, ad infinitum. They could call it the "special edition color" or something. That would give people an opportunity to own a unique color if they wanted, and may even motivate some purchases by offering a unique "gotta have it" color that will also be uncommon. It would not add the same cost as adding "more colors" since you wouldn't have any more than normal in total.

If they wanted to make things easy, they could just use other colors in the GM paint catalog. If they wanted to make it really neat, they could dabble in colors like oranges, purples, yellows, "grabber" colors (like 60's chryslers), color flopping paints, and candy and pearl finishes.

I'm sure people would at least pay a couple hundred dollars more to be unique.
